智能语音机器人的云端部署与本地化配置
随着人工智能技术的飞速发展,智能语音机器人已经成为众多行业的热门应用。它们在客服、教育、医疗等多个领域发挥着重要作用,极大地提高了工作效率和用户体验。然而,智能语音机器人的云端部署与本地化配置却是一个复杂而关键的过程。本文将讲述一个智能语音机器人的故事,带您了解其云端部署与本地化配置的全过程。
故事的主人公是一位名叫小明的程序员。小明所在的公司是一家专注于智能语音技术的研究与开发的企业。为了提升公司产品的竞争力,他们决定研发一款能够满足不同行业需求的智能语音机器人。
一、需求分析
在项目启动阶段,小明带领团队对市场进行了深入调研。他们发现,目前市场上的智能语音机器人大多存在以下问题:
功能单一:多数机器人只能完成简单的问答,无法满足用户多样化的需求。
语音识别准确率低:部分机器人在识别语音时,存在误识别、漏识别等问题,导致用户体验不佳。
部署难度大:传统智能语音机器人需要依赖本地服务器,部署和运维成本较高。
针对这些问题,小明团队决定研发一款具有以下特点的智能语音机器人:
功能丰富:支持多场景应用,如客服、教育、医疗等。
语音识别准确率高:采用先进的语音识别技术,降低误识别率。
云端部署与本地化配置:降低部署难度,降低运维成本。
二、云端部署
为了实现云端部署,小明团队采用了以下技术方案:
云服务器:选择具有高性能、高可靠性的云服务器,确保机器人稳定运行。
语音识别与合成服务:利用云服务提供商提供的语音识别与合成API,实现语音识别与合成功能。
数据存储与处理:采用云数据库存储用户数据,利用云计算技术进行数据处理和分析。
安全防护:部署防火墙、入侵检测系统等安全措施,确保数据安全。
具体部署步骤如下:
注册云服务器账号,购买所需资源。
部署操作系统和应用程序,如Python、Java等。
配置网络环境,确保机器人能够访问外部资源。
集成语音识别与合成API,实现语音识别与合成功能。
部署云数据库,存储用户数据。
部署安全防护措施,确保数据安全。
三、本地化配置
为了满足不同用户的需求,小明团队对智能语音机器人进行了本地化配置。以下是本地化配置的主要步骤:
界面设计:根据不同行业和用户需求,设计个性化的界面。
语音识别与合成:针对不同地区和语言,选择合适的语音识别与合成模型。
功能模块配置:根据用户需求,配置相应的功能模块,如客服、教育、医疗等。
数据本地化:将用户数据存储在本地数据库,确保数据安全。
系统优化:针对不同用户场景,进行系统优化,提高性能和稳定性。
四、总结
通过云端部署与本地化配置,小明团队成功研发了一款功能丰富、性能稳定的智能语音机器人。该机器人已在多个行业得到应用,为用户带来了便利。未来,小明团队将继续优化产品,为用户提供更优质的服务。
在这个过程中,小明深刻体会到云端部署与本地化配置的重要性。他认为,只有充分了解用户需求,才能研发出满足用户期望的产品。同时,云端部署与本地化配置能够降低成本、提高效率,为企业带来更多价值。
猜你喜欢:AI实时语音